Output d2f44c3024bb92f94d241419745f8740afa89104eb91e5a00ccb05aabd3541ee:15

value
29920340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9decf429d95756244beb56e96e19c598cd366764 OP_EQUAL
address
3G63sVo1cLmafLdMF3MRa6LYgSpPxUiQfm
transaction
d2f44c3024bb92f94d241419745f8740afa89104eb91e5a00ccb05aabd3541ee
spent
true